which behaviors would the nurse expect the client to do during the working phase of a therapeutic relationship

Medicine
1 answer:
mr Goodwill [35]2 years ago
6 0

The nurse would expect the client would do insight and incorporate alternative behaviors during the working phase of a therapeutic relationship.

<h3>What does therapeutic relationship mean?</h3>

The relationship between a healthcare provider and a client or patient is referred to as a therapeutic relationship. It is the way a therapist and a client intend to interact and bring about positive change in the client.

There is a distinct beginning and finish to the therapeutic relationship. It advances via the aforementioned four stages: commitment, process, change, and termination.

<h3>What is a good therapeutic relationship?</h3>

Mutual regard, trust, and concern. general agreement over the therapy's objectives and tasks. Cooperative decision-making. Participation of both parties in "the job" of the therapy. the capability of discussing "here-and-now" elements of one's relationships with others.

The site of gas exchange in the lungs is the _________________.
Eduardwww [97]

Answer:

Alveoli.

Explanation:

Respiration may be defined as the process of exchange of gases between the environment, lungs and body tissues. Energy is given off during the process of respiration.

The alveoli is a ballon like structure present in the lungs when gases are inflated in the alveoli. The alveoli increses the surface area for the exchange of gases. Oxygen is transferred in the body tissue from the alveoli.

Thus, alveoli is the main site of gas exchange in the lungs.

A 77-lb patient is ordered aminophylline 3 mg/kg po every 6 hours. The oral liquid is available as 105 mg/5 mL. What volume shou
Goryan [66]
Whoever wrote this question loves math, hahaha.

Start by converting 77# to kg, which is 34.9kg

The medication dose is 3 mg/kg, so 3 x 34.9 = 104.7 mg.

Rounding up, that’s 105 mg, and the medication comes in 105mg/5 mL, so they would get 5 mL.

If you’re not allowed to round, you’ll get 4.985 mL, and you’re not going to have the ability to accurately micromeasure like that with an oral medication.

In a bone marrow aspiration, a health care provider uses a thin needle to remove a small amount of liquid bone marrow, usually from a spot in the back of your hipbone (pelvis).

A normal PT with an abnormal aPTT means that the defect lies within the intrinsic pathway, and a deficiency of factor VIII, IX, X, or XIII is suggested. A normal aPTT with an abnormal PT means that the defect lies within the extrinsic pathway and suggests a possible factor VII deficiency

Bleeding time is a medical test done on someone to assess their platelets function. It involves making a patient bleed, then timing how long it takes for them to stop bleeding using a stopwatch or other suitable devices.
